分层测试题及答案.docxVIP

  • 0
  • 0
  • 约4.74千字
  • 约 8页
  • 2026-02-18 发布于河南
  • 举报

分层测试题及答案

姓名:__________考号:__________

一、单选题(共10题)

1.什么是Python编程语言的特点?()

A.易于学习

B.运行效率高

C.支持面向对象编程

D.以上都是

2.在Python中,如何定义一个函数?()

A.deffunction_name():

B.function_name():

C.functionfunction_name():

D.function_namedef():

3.在Python中,如何进行字符串的切片操作?()

A.string[start:end]

B.string[end:start]

C.string[start:end+1]

D.string[end+1:start]

4.在Python中,如何进行列表的添加元素操作?()

A.list.append(element)

B.list.add(element)

C.list.insert(index,element)

D.list.extend(element)

5.在Python中,如何定义一个类?()

A.classClassName():

B.ClassNameclass():

C.classClassName:ClassName()

D.ClassNameclassClassName():

6.在Python中,如何获取一个字典的键值对?()

A.dict[key]

B.dict.get(key)

C.dict.keys()

D.dict.values()

7.在Python中,如何进行文件的读取操作?()

A.file=open(filename,r)

B.file=open(filename,w)

C.file=open(filename,a)

D.file=open(filename,x)

8.在Python中,如何进行条件判断?()

A.ifcondition:

B.ifcondition;:

C.if(condition):

D.ifcondition:then

9.在Python中,如何进行循环操作?()

A.foriinrange(start,end):

B.fori=range(start,end):

C.whileiend:

D.whilei=end:

10.在Python中,如何定义一个变量?()

A.variable=value

B.variable:=value

C.variablevalue

D.variable:=value;

二、多选题(共5题)

11.以下哪些是Python中的基本数据类型?()

A.整数

B.浮点数

C.字符串

D.列表

E.字典

12.在Python中,以下哪些操作符用于比较两个值?()

A.==

B.!=

C.

D.

E.+=

13.以下哪些是Python中常用的字符串方法?()

A.upper()

B.lower()

C.split()

D.join()

E.find()

14.在Python中,以下哪些是控制流程的关键字?()

A.if

B.else

C.for

D.while

E.return

15.以下哪些是Python中定义类的方法?()

A.__init__()

B.__str__()

C.__add__()

D.__del__()

E.__len__()

三、填空题(共5题)

16.Python中的数据类型可以分为几个基本类别?

17.在Python中,如何调用一个函数的某个参数?

18.在Python中,如何定义一个二维数组(列表的列表)?

19.在Python中,如何获取字符串中指定位置的字符?

20.在Python中,如何将一个整数转换为字符串?

四、判断题(共5题)

21.在Python中,所有变量在使用前都必须先声明。()

A.正确B.错误

22.Python中的列表是不可变的。()

A.正确B.错误

23.在Python中,字典的键必须是唯一的。()

A.正确B.错误

24.Python中的for循环只能遍历序列类型。()

A.正确B.错误

25.在Pyth

文档评论(0)

1亿VIP精品文档

相关文档